Huntsville Reports on Top Private K-12 Schools for 2025
Huntsville, AL – A new ranking has emerged highlighting the best private K-12 schools in the Huntsville metro area, featuring key insights that aim to assist parents in making informed educational decisions. The rankings, compiled by Stacker using data from Niche, are based on five weighted factors: top colleges score, college enrollment, culture & diversity grade, parent/student surveys, and student-teacher ratio. This comprehensive evaluation prioritizes schools that excel in diverse educational environments while maintaining high standards.

Frequently Asked Questions
What factors were considered in the ranking of private K-12 schools?
The rankings are based on top colleges score, college enrollment, culture & diversity grade, parent/student surveys, and student-teacher ratio.
How can the rankings help parents in their decision-making process?
The rankings provide a comparative analysis of schools, allowing parents to weigh their options based on academic quality, class size, and overall school environment.
Why is the student-teacher ratio important?
A lower student-teacher ratio often indicates a more personalized education, which can lead to better academic outcomes for students.
